This aircraft bears a striking resemblance to the aircraft - YA9, that flew off against the YA10 in trials before it became the A-10 thunderbolt II (Warthog).


The Frogfoot apparently carriers all its tools in a special container on one of its pylons when stationed at a forward base of operations. Another interesting fact that is that this aircraft will fly on almost any form of parafin, including vehicle diesel fuel. A very drable CAS package from the Soviets (Russians).o_O
